 Bill Status of SB2758  103rd General Assembly


Short Description:  PROBATE-MARRIAGE OF WARD

Senate Sponsors
Sen. Karina Villa

Statutes Amended In Order of Appearance
755 ILCS 5/11a-17from Ch. 110 1/2, par. 11a-17


Synopsis As Introduced
Amends the Probate Act of 1975. Allows a ward in guardianship to marry if the ward understands the nature, effect, duties, and obligations of marriage. Provides that prior consent of the guardian of the person or estate or approval of the court is not required for the ward to enter into a marriage. Provides that a guardian may contest the validity of a marriage under the Illinois Marriage and Dissolution of Marriage Act.
